Captain Bob... take it off the board please...  for CNU, it is an exhibition game... there are a large number of them... the games in the discussion are real count em in the record games...  (note - any game prior to 11/15 is exhibition - a real game, but doe not count in the D3 team records).

Clearly an exhibition game, but Augustana (Il) is playing at Valparaiso tomorrow.  Augustana is ranked # 2 in the pre-season d3hoops.com poll, so this poses an intriguing matchup between a top tier Division 3 team and a solid mid major.

Coverage, including links to the webcast can be found on Augustana's web site at http://www.augustana.edu/x11824.xml?eventid=7177


Augustana has a considerable size advantage over the Crusaders.
